Transaction 353826afac5c7bc79e347bc8daa18499885ec916e539bbcc28fda4e698bc37ae

2 Input
2 Outputs
  • 353826afac5c7bc79e347bc8daa18499885ec916e539bbcc28fda4e698bc37ae:0
  • value  21971852
    address  1FY4ZcGGqGiVq1dZcR8Q4gGGdXxmB1wzMn
  • 353826afac5c7bc79e347bc8daa18499885ec916e539bbcc28fda4e698bc37ae:1
  • value  100000000
    address  1CxyszTu1DE26fBMX7UrAUX2xKPXJdBuyu